Writing tips in this lesson

✓ Writing Tip-1: An Article, Possessive, Demonstrative (this/that) + Noun + of + Noun


✓ Writing Tip-2: Pronouns make double possessives after the preposition “of”
(of + mine/ours/yours/hers/his/theirs)
✓ Writing Tip-3: Possessive Adj + Noun = Possessive Pronoun (To save repetition)
✓ Writing Tip-4: In modern English, nouns do not make double possessives.
✓ Writing Tip-5: Drop “s” after the apostrophe for plural common nouns.
✓ Writing Tip-6: When
Subject = The object of a verb/ preposition → Use Reflexive Pronouns
✓ Writing Tip-7: To bring more emphasis on the doer of an action → Use Emphatic
pronouns before or after the main verb.
✓ Writing Tip-8: Emphatic Pronouns are not separated by commas.
✓ Writing Tip-9: Can (present/future) + verb = Is, am, are + able to + verb
✓ Writing Tip-10: Could (past) + verb ≠ was, were + able to + verb
